Crema Catalana Ice Cream Sundaes
Crema catalana is a delicious custard covered with caramelized sugar. There are several Catalan chefs who take credit for having transformed this popular dessert into an ice cream. This version is served in glasses or bowls and drizzled with a creamy caramel sauce.

Shrimp Tart
It's important to note that the pumpernickel used in this tart should be very dense. Although we prefer the light-brown Danish pumpernickel, the dark German-style variety works just as well. For the filling we've suggested lumpfish caviar, which is readily available in the States; in Sweden, the fish roe called lojrom would probably be used. It comes from bleak, an ocean fish from the Baltic Sea.
